What the Data Says About

Self rising crust four cheese pizza by Kroger carries a composite safety score of 100/100, which we classify as "Safe" on our four-tier shelf-label framework. The score is computed by mapping each labeled ingredient against FDA Substances Added to Food (SAFFA) regulatory status and CSPI Chemical Cuisine classifications, then penalizing the overall product for each additive rated as caution-or-worse. Product data originates from the OpenFoodFacts collaborative catalog; safety annotations come from federal regulators and the Center for Science in the Public Interest.

Our scan did not identify any ingredients in this product that FDA SAFFA or CSPI Chemical Cuisine data flags as requiring caution or avoidance at the time of analysis. That is a meaningful clean-label signal, though it does not account for personal allergens, regional recalls, or inspection findings not reflected in federal additive databases. The per-ingredient breakdown below shows the source-level classification for each component.

On the NOVA processing scale, Self rising crust four cheese pizza is classified as Group 4 (Ultra-processed). NOVA measures industrial processing intensity rather than ingredient-level safety, so it complements the SAFFA and CSPI ratings: a product can be clean on additive flags but heavily processed, or lightly processed but carry individually flagged ingredients. Combining both lenses gives a fuller picture than either alone. The Nutri-Score grade of D reflects nutritional balance — calories, saturated fat, sugar, sodium versus fiber, protein, and produce content — which again is a distinct dimension from additive safety and worth weighing alongside the scores above.

Full Ingredient List

Crust (enriched wheat flour [wheat flour, niacin, reduced iron, thiamine, mononitrate, riboflavin, folic acid], water, soybean oil, sugar, yeast, contains 2% or less of: leavening [corn starch, sodium aluminum phosphate and/or sodium aluminum phosphate, sodium bicarbonate], salt, enzyme, ascorbic acid, wheat starch, degermed corn meal, soy lecithin), low moisture, part skim mozzarella cheese (pasteurized part skim milk, cheese cultures, salt, enzymes), sauce (water, tomato concentrate, seasoning [salt, spices, dehydrated garlic, natural flavors, sugar, malic acid]), contains less than 2% of: cheese blend (parmesan cheese [pasteurized milk, cheese cultures, rennet], romano cheese made from cow's milk [pasteurized milk, cheese cultures, salt, rennet], asiago cheese [pasteurized milk, cheese cultures, salt, rennet])
